Job description

Are you looking to make a difference in patients’ lives with a company that values your expertise? Join us in our mission of delivering compassionate healthcare where it matters most –– at home.

Key Responsibilities
  • Travel with CCs to referral partner offices and develop relationships with them, learn each account’s referral patterns, and determine their preferred delivery method. Update and manage delivery methods in WellSky as necessary.
  • Travel regularly in the field to referral partner offices to obtain signatures for current or outstanding orders.
  • Work with referral partners to obtain outstanding paperwork when a CC is no longer working within the agency or at the branch.
  • Monitor WellSky to ensure the physician information is correct on the profile page, and research and correct any errors in that profile.
  • Submit Smartsheet for changes to CC’s assigned referral sources (MD’s, facilities/hospitals, etc.) or any other WellSky information that requires updates.
  • Document in WellSky daily the work performed to obtain current or outstanding orders by date, action, and follow-up date. Follow-up on the previous week’s activity.
  • Assist with the escalation of orders by working with the home office, referral partner, and CC
  • Participate in meetings to discuss and provide updates on outstanding F2F, hand carry, orders, escalations, and communicate plans to obtain missing documents.
  • Print and prepare orders for each CC and discuss a plan for obtaining signatures on a weekly basis. Be available to send outstanding orders/F2F/hand carry orders to the CC if they are in a referral sources office and will obtain signature during that visit.
  • Run F2F and orders reports on a weekly basis and work with CC to ensure orders are complete within 14 days or as appropriate according to the patient’s case.
  • Review potential write-off accounts with RDS to determine a plan for resolution or submission for write-off.
  • Communicate professionally with all departments to resolve outstanding orders.
  • Respond promptly to all inquiries with a resolution to concerns and or discrepancies in a timely manner.
  • Comply with HIPAA regulations on all accounts.
Qualifications
  • Must have a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• Must have previous experience working with an EMR system.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and time management skills.
  • Advanced typing, computer skills (MS Office), and the ability to multitask across multiple software systems while maintaining the integrity of the data.
  • Excels in a deadline driven environment
  • Ability to remain productive when faced with high workloads and deadlines.
